A feasibility study of two variants of a blended functional remediation programme for euthymic patients with bipolar
Susan Zyto1,2,3, Ralph W Kupka3,4,5, Annet Nugter2
1Department of Medical Psychology, Dijklander Hospital, Hoorn, The Netherlands.
Background:
Bipolar disorder (BD) is associated with reduced psychosocial functioning, partly due to cognitive impairments. Functional remediation (FR), aimed at ameliorating daily functioning, is based on psychoeducation and strategies to cope with cognitive problems. Given the limited number of studies in patients with BD, more studies are needed to evaluate different FR programmes.
Methods:
A total of 29 euthymic patients with BD-I followed a 12-session FR programme consisting of both group and individual sessions, offered in two variants: one in-person and one online (video conferencing). Both variants were supported by E-health modules. Feasibility was the primary outcome, as measured with dropout rates and attendance, as well as questionnaires about patients' experiences with the programme. The secondary aim was to explore effects on psychosocial functioning.
Results:
Results show an acceptable dropout rate. Attendance was good as 83% visited at least 10 sessions. Analyses of participants' experiences revealed gain of insight and implementation of learned strategies in daily life. Independently working with the E-health modules did not appear feasible. Exploratory analyses showed a significant improvement in psychosocial functioning for both variants.
Limitations:
The results of the effect analysis are preliminary, due to a small sample and lack of a control group.
Conclusions:
This FR programme showed good feasibility for both the in-person and online variant. Online treatment has advantages as it can reach out to a larger group of participants. Effect analyses indicated reduction in psychosocial impairments in both variants. Larger controlled studies are needed to investigate the treatment effects of the current FR programme.
